Hozen Guitars
Hozen Guitars are voiced by Ho Zen Yong in Singapore and built by his small team in Guangzhou — a four-person collaborative shop turning out four or five instruments a month, all hand-voiced by Hozen himself. He trained directly under Ervin Somogyi, the modern dean of responsive acoustic voicing, and the Blue Label line carries that lineage forward in his own idiom: a signature lattice bracing pattern, rigid-rim construction, the Manzer wedge for tonal depth in a compact body, soundport, and beveled Laskin armrest. The output volume is unusual for a luthier-led shop — most peers at this level make twenty or thirty a year — which makes the Blue Labels meaningfully more findable than equivalent single-builder work, without the multi-year wait that typically gates Somogyi-school voicing.
The Fretted Buffalo
The Fretted Buffalo is an online-first dealer based near Buffalo, New York, working from a deliberately small, curated catalog rather than a sprawling floor — instruments chosen, in the shop's words, for tone, craftsmanship, and individuality. Most of their guitars ship across the country, so the business is built around earning a distance buyer's trust: detailed descriptions, professional photography, and demonstration videos on each listing, backed by a seven-day approval period and free insured shipping within the continental US. The boutique acoustic shelf leans into the modern fingerstyle and flatpicking names — Bourgeois (and its Touchstone line), Huss & Dalton, Lowden, Furch, Atkin, and Boucher — alongside Gallagher, Hozen, Avenir, McIlroy, and McNally, with the occasional used Martin or Preston Thompson rounding out the catalog.
